IMPERIAL POLITICS.
[Sptciai. to Fbksb Association.] LONDON, Johb 3. Sir Eeginald Hanson, who was Iford Mayor of London in 1886, has been elected to fill the vacancy for the City of London in the Houge of Commons, caused by the death of Sir Robert A. Fowler. Mr Edward g, W, de Cobain, M.P. -for the. Eastern division of Belfast, 'against whom serious criminal charges were preferred, aud who absconded from the country, has declined to return to England, to meet the charges. Mr de Cobain was, early in May last, identified at Bilboa, in Spain, where he was conducting religious services.
